Call each program on the list of referrals you receive. Confirm the information on the profile and ask if they have an opening for your child. |
|
|
Some additional questions to ask are:
What is the daily program for the children?
How many children does the provider care for?
What are the ages of the children in the group?
What are the fees and what do they include?

Visit at least three potential programs and providers:
Allow at least 30-45 minutes for the visit and be sure children are in care during your visit. Use the checklist to ask questions and to make notes on what you see at each program. |
|
|
Ask for references from parents whose children are currently in the program. Ask if their children enjoy the program and what they like most and least about the program. |
|
|
In the end, trust your instincts and enroll your child in the program that you feel most comfortable with. |
